    Imagine slices of Granny Smith apples dipped into a thin churro batter and then fried. The whip-cream dip makes is super delicious!
    Jay P.

    Each apple fry reminded me of a McDonald's Apple Pie but with a more interesting crunchy shell. They use Granny Smith apples and offset the sour taste with cinnamon and sugar dusting and optional free whip cream to dip. The size is nice and shareable for our family of four and provided a nice snack without making us feel bad after. It's a unique offering at Legoland compared to the typical burgers, chicken tenders, hotdogs, etc.. you can get at other theme parks. Conveniently, it's right next to the huge wood playground with plenty of places to sit. It is a known destination so sometimes the lines are very long but can move fast. Oddly, sometimes it's strangely deserted and you can go right up to the front. If the line is short this is also a place you can ask for free ice, very useful on hot days like today.

They come in a small French fry looking container with a little compartment at the top for the vanilla flavored cream. The Apple fries are small in size, not long like some regular fries. They are coated with cinnamon sugar to sweeten the tartness of the granny apples. And to add to the sweetness, top it off with a dip in the vanilla cream!
